#FORECAST FOR THE NEW WEEK: NOVEMBER 25-29, 2013 Lets revise #economic events that can affect #Forex trading next week. Pending #sales on the US real estate #market should grow from -5,6% to 2,0% on Monday according to the forecast. #USD can slightly improve its positions while waiting for the #news release, however, we think that actual data will be lower than a #forecast, which will lead to the #dollar rate’s decrease. Information about building permits in the #US should be published at 3:30 p.m on Tuesday, November 26. According to the forecast, the number of #permits will grow. Consumer Confidence #Index should be published right after that, and it is also expected to grow. This info can support #USD. British #GDP should be published on Wednesday, and high volatility is expected for #GBPUSD. Slight deviation from the forecast can seriously affect pound’s rate. In the US, information about orders for durables will be published at 3:30 p.m., and Michigan Consumer Sentiment #Index should be published at 4:55 p.m. Both indices have a positive forecast, which can support #dollar, however, it makes sense to wait for the #news. #US markets will be closed on Thursday because of the #Thanksgiving celebration. As for the other countries: #Swiss #GDP should be published, and it is expected to decrease. #CHF can lose its positions while waiting for the news release. #Germany’s unemployment stats will be published on Thursday as well: forecast expects German #Unemployment Change to grow from 1K to 2K. Euro’s positions can improve. #EURUSD’s and #GBPUSD’s rates might grow on Thursday. Info about #Germany’s retail sales will be published on Friday at 9:00 a.m. Forecast expects index to grow. #Eurozone’s unemployment rate should remain the same, and #Canadian GDP should grow from 1,7% to 2,0%.
